Gill Out For Six Weeks


Bristol Rovers midfielder and Captain Matt Gill has been ruled out for around six weeks due to injury.

Gill will need surgery on his knee which has been causing him problems and forced him to miss Saturdays 3-1 home win over Northampton. It looks like around six weeks at the moment, but it could end up being as long as twelve weeks depending on what the find.

The 32 year old former Norwich City midfielder has made 11 appearances so far for Rovers this season. Gill signed for Rovers in the summer of 2010 and has made 46 starts to date and 1 sub appearance. Manager Mark McGhee will look to bring in a replacement for Gill, but has admitted his hands are tied a little due to finance’s.
